Hi,
See org.apache.wicket.RestartResponseException#RestartResponseException
You need
public RestartResponseException(final IPageProvider pageProvider,
final RedirectPolicy redirectPolicy)
constructor with RedirectPolicy#NEVER_REDIRECT as second parameter.

Hi There ;
How do i get the absolute path to the WEB-INF directory in wicket 1.5 ?
regards.
Josh
Oh i got it. String path =
WebApplication.get().getServletContext().getRealPath("/WEB-INF") ;
